Why These Are the Top Kia Repair Auto Repair Shops in Frankfort

** The Kia repair market in Frankfort is characterized by a clear bifurcation between the authorized dealership and a small number of highly competent independent shops. The overall quality of specialized Kia service is good, but options are limited. * **Average Quality & Competition:** The competition is not intense in terms of volume, but the few top-tier independents (like Frankfort Car Care and AutoBahn Motors) compete on quality, personalized service, and often, lower labor rates than the dealership. The dealership (Fox Valley Kia) operates in a near-monopoly for factory-mandated services, which limits direct competition for warranty and recall work. * **Typical Pricing:** Pricing follows a standard tiered structure. Authorized dealership labor rates are typically the highest ($150-$180/hr). The top independents command premium rates as well ($120-$150/hr) but are often 15-25% less than the dealer for the same non-warranty procedure. For complex jobs like engine carbon cleaning or DCT service, customers should expect estimates in the $500-$1,500 range, depending on the scope. * **Consumer Choice:** Frankfort Kia owners are well-served by having both a trusted dealership for specific needs and excellent independent alternatives for general maintenance, older vehicles, or situations where a second opinion is desired. The key for consumers is to match their specific need (e.g., a warranty recall vs. a carbon cleaning) with the appropriate provider from the list above.

What are the most common Kia repair issues you see for vehicles driven in the Frankfort, IL area?

In Frankfort, we frequently address issues related to our climate and road conditions. These include battery failures due to extreme temperature swings, suspension wear from potholes on roads like US-45 or LaGrange Road, and for older Kia models, engine concerns like those covered under specific manufacturer campaigns that a local specialist would know.

How can I find a trustworthy, specialized Kia repair shop in Frankfort?

Look for a shop with certified Kia technicians (ASE certification is a strong indicator) and one that uses genuine or OEM-quality parts. In Frankfort, checking local reviews and asking for recommendations in community groups can point you to shops with proven expertise, as general mechanics may not have the latest diagnostic software for Kia's systems.

When should I seek local service instead of driving to a distant Kia dealership?

For most rout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and many common repairs, a reputable local Frankfort shop can provide faster, often more affordable service. For complex warranty work or specific recall repairs that require dealership tools, you may need to visit the nearest dealerships in Tinley Park or Orland Park.

Are Kia repairs in Frankfort generally more affordable than dealership prices?

Yes, independent repair shops in Frankfort typically have lower labor rates than dealerships, while providing the same quality of service for most repairs. You save on labor and often have more flexibility with high-quality aftermarket parts, though for major warranty-covered components, the dealership may be the required option.

What local factors in Frankfort should influence my Kia's maintenance schedule?

Frankfort's seasonal extremes demand attention to specific items. Prioritize battery testing before winter, more frequent tire rotations due to rough winter roads and construction, and checking the air conditioning system before summer. Using a local shop familiar with these regional stresses ensures they proactively check related components.
